FAQ: Why does Matchforge pause during peak hours? The matching service runs a generational collector; full GC pauses occur when the candidate cache churns. As a contractor, tune heap flags only in staging. To pull GC logs from the sealed diagnostics bucket, use the recovery passphrase, which is:

vault phrase of yahif-hahaf = istael-gorir-fenwyn-belael-novys-novok-juldor

Welcome aboard! The Lanternfold public API paginates everything with cursor tokens — no offset params, so don't bother asking. Page sizes are capped server-side and we'll silently clamp anything bigger, which trips up new integrators constantly. Cursors expire, so don't stash them overnight. If you hit 429s, back off exponentially; the gateway is strict. The limits you actually need to remember are these.

tuning constants:
QUOTAS = {
    "quenael": 10,
    "oliwyn": 1,
}

Subject: Inkflow cut-over complete

Hi on-call,

We finished the cut-over of the Inkflow markdown rendering pipeline to the new Quillbase cluster at 14:00. Old renderers are drained; traffic is fully on v3. Sanitizer rules and the footnote extension carried over cleanly, though table alignment edge cases may still page you — roll back via the Marlowe dashboard if error rates climb past 2%. If you need to verify anything manually, the active service configuration is below.

settings of fafog-haduf:
ZORIX_PIN=4648
ZORIX_METRICS_HOST=metrics.zorix.paliqsys.corp
ZORIX_LOG_LEVEL=info
ZORIX_TENANT=druix

# Artifact Signing — Checkout Load Tests

All Cartwheel checkout load-test builds must be signed before the Thresher rig will accept them. Unsigned artifacts are rejected at ingest. Run the sign step after the bundle job, not before. Support: if a tester reports a rejected build, verify the artifact hash first, then re-sign. The active signing key for the load-test pipeline is below.

rollout seal: bky19_M1Zvn1YQwEBTy4XxP3H